Who's behind puremetics, and how did the brand come about? +
We love founder stories built on genuine conviction, and puremetics has exactly that to offer: as a teenager, Chris Cosma was already experimenting with skin-friendly creams and shower gels, partly because his mother could barely tolerate conventional cosmetics. Together with Chidobe Ogbukagu, he founded the company in Hanover in 2020 with a clear goal: to rethink cosmetics completely without plastic. That idea has since grown into a range of around 100 products for body, face, and hair, all produced in-house in Lower Saxony.
Are puremetics products really vegan and cruelty-free? +
Yes, without exception: every formula is completely free of animal-derived ingredients and is not tested on animals. The brand is accordingly listed on PETA's 'Beauty Without Bunnies' list. How can cosmetics even be 100% plastic-free, including shampoo and shower gel? +
This works mainly through solid rather than liquid formulas: at puremetics, shower gel, shampoo, and conditioner come as solid bars or as powder you mix yourself with water, packaged in kraft paper instead of a plastic bottle. Even small details like coatings on paper bags or seals in screw caps are consistently avoided. In the end, there's really no plastic left, neither in the product nor in the packaging.
How long-lasting are solid soap bars and shampoo powders compared to liquid products? +
Noticeably more long-lasting than you might expect: with normal use, a bar of solid soap typically lasts two to three months, often replacing several bottles of shower gel. Using the powder products takes a bit of practice, but in return you avoid shipping around unnecessary water, and the packaging waste that comes with it. How do I properly use the solid hair soap or the Schaumie shampoo bar? +
Much like a regular shampoo: wet your hair and the bar, work up a lather briefly between your hands or directly in your hair and massage it in, then rinse thoroughly. It's worth being a little patient at first, since your hair needs time to adjust during the transition to solid care. Matching accessories such as a soap dish help the bar last longer between uses. What does puremetics actually do for sustainability beyond the packaging? +
Quite a lot: for every order, puremetics works with partner CleanHub to fund the recovery of one kilogram of plastic waste from coastal regions before it reaches the oceans. The company also supports species and marine conservation projects, for example to protect sea turtles. Packaging is made exclusively from recycled or biodegradable materials instead of plastic.
